Selecionar impressora e imprimir sem preview, VB.net

.NET

14/05/2014

Bom dia, tem como escolher a impressora e imprimir um arquivo texto sem abrir a tela de preview em VB.net?
Sendo, quando clicar no botão para imprimir, o texto é impresso na impressora que selecionar via código e imprimir imediatamente.
Helio Costa

Helio Costa

Curtidas 0

Respostas

Helio Costa

Helio Costa

14/05/2014

Ola, pessoal!

Isto parece uma coisa impossível de fazer?
Seria o comando print do VB6.
Alguem pode ajudar?
GOSTEI 0
Welson Muniz

Welson Muniz

14/05/2014

se não conseguiu ainda. tenta isso aqui

Dim info = New ProcessStartInfo
Dim p = New Process()
info.Verb = "print"
info.FileName = "nome do arquivo que deseja imprimir"
info.CreateNoWindow = True
info.WindowStyle = ProcessWindowStyle.Hidden
p.StartInfo = info
p.Start()
p.WaitForInputIdle()
System.Threading.Thread.Sleep(3000)

peguei o esquema daqui
http://devbrasil.net/group/cdesenvolvendores/forum/topics/imprimir-arquivo-pdf-via-c-digo-diretamente-pela-aplica-o-c?commentId=2307362%3AComment%3A248233&groupId=2307362%3AGroup%3A4247
GOSTEI 0
Welson Muniz

Welson Muniz

14/05/2014

se der certo manda um ok
GOSTEI 0
POSTAR